H.B. No. 0088

Distribution of severance tax.

 

Sponsored By:        Joint Minerals, Business and Economic Development Interim Committee

 

AN ACT relating to administration of government; amending provisions for the deposit and distribution of certain severance taxes as specified; repealing specified distribution of certain severance taxes; eliminating duplicative language; making technical and conforming amendments; and providing for an effective date.

      "Section 2.  W.S. 9-2-1014.1(b) and 39-14-801(c)(i), (ii) and by creating a new paragraph (iii) are amended to read:

9-2-1014.1.  State budget; requests by recipients of certain earmarked funds for additional funding from the budget reserve account.

(b)  The total amount available for the purpose of this section shall be the estimated deposits into the budget reserve account for the next biennial budget period under W.S. 9-4-601(d)(iv) and 39-14-801(c)(ii) 39-14-801(c)(i) and (ii).

39-14-801.  Severance tax distributions; distribution account created; formula.

(c)  After making distributions under subsection (b) of this section, distributions under subsection (d) of this section shall be made from the severance tax distribution account. The amount of distributions under subsection (d) of this section shall not exceed one hundred fifty-five million dollars ($155,000,000.00) in any fiscal year. To the extent that distributions under subsection (d) of this section would exceed that amount in any fiscal year, the excess shall be credited:

(i)  One-third (1/3) to the general fund; and

(ii)  Two-thirds (2/3) One-third (1/3) to the budget reserve account;. and

(iii)  One-third (1/3) to the permanent Wyoming mineral trust fund.".
